    If we put 2 players up teams would still have 4 or 5 attackers in the box so all the 2 players do on the half way line is allow the attackers a free run at our defenders. Normally attacking teams still leave 1 player on the half way line so all you do is take away 1 or 2 players from the edge of the box with their main attackers in the box. If this didn't work you wouldn't see so many top managers doing it all over Europe. We've also not got the tallest team so man marking on corners would likely leave mismatches in the area.

    It's not just about the counter attack though. Having a player on the edge of the box and on the half way line means that once the ball is initially cleared we have a chance of retaining possession and alleviating the pressure. Failing that though, those players can at least put pressure on the ball rather than allowing the opposition time and space to deliver another decent ball back into our penalty area.
